About Us

From a small Cincinnati grocery store over a century ago, we've grown into the nation's largest grocer with nearly 2,800 stores across 35 states under 28 different names. As America's grocer, we pride ourselves on bringing diverse teams together with a passion for food and people, united by the purpose: To Feed the Human Spirit. We innovate continuously to create exceptional experiences for our customers, communities, and colleagues, with food at the heart of it all.

Operational Roles
  • INBOUND: Receive and transfer goods from suppliers into totes.
  • OUTBOUND: Pick and pack customer orders in ambient, chill, or freezer environments.
  • DISPATCH: Assist in loading or moving customer orders throughout the center.
  • Achieve productivity goals and targets.
  • Flex across operational roles in inbound, outbound, and dispatch areas.
  • Resolve minor production issues or seek leadership assistance as needed.
  • Follow quality and accuracy guidelines to ensure positive customer experiences.
  • Adhere to operational processes to enhance efficiency.
  • Follow safety and food safety protocols, reporting issues promptly.
  • Provide feedback and suggestions for continuous improvement.
